LEFTOVER PIZZA BREAKFAST CASSEROLE



Leftover Pizza Breakfast Casserole image

I love breakfast casserole and was looking in the fridge for bread and breakfast meat to put in it. I pushed the pizza aside to realize I have no breakfast meats. Then it dawned on me... Can be assembled the night before and stored in the fridge until morning.

Provided by Prov31woman

Categories     100+ Breakfast and Brunch Recipes     Eggs     Breakfast Pizza Recipes

Time 1h20m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 12

cooking spray
3 slices leftover pizza, cut into 3/4-inch squares
4 eggs, beaten
1 cup milk
1 (8 ounce) package shredded mozzarella cheese
⅓ cup chopped onion
3 tablespoons butter, melted
1 clove garlic, minced
1 teaspoon dried oregano
½ teaspoon salt
¼ cup grated Parmesan cheese, or to taste
¼ teaspoon red pepper flakes, or to taste

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Spray a 9x9-inch baking dish with cooking spray.
  • Arrange pizza squares in the prepared baking dish. Mix eggs, milk, mozzarella cheese, onion, butter, garlic, oregano, and salt together in a large bowl; pour over pizza pieces. Top with Parmesan cheese and red pepper flakes. Cover dish with aluminum foil.
  • Bake in the preheated oven for 45 minutes. Remove foil and continue baking until eggs are set and Parmesan cheese is melted, about 20 more minutes.
